Gestronol (
BAN Tooltip British Approved Name ), also known as gestonorone , as well as 17α-hydroxy-19-norprogesterone or 17α-hydroxy-19-norpregn-4-ene-3,20-dione , is a
progestin of the
19-norprogesterone and
17α-hydroxyprogesterone groups which was never marketed.
[1]
[2]
[3] The C17α
caproate
ester of gestronol,
gestonorone caproate (gestronol hexanoate), in contrast, has been marketed.
[1]
[2]
[3]
Gestronol shows relatively low
affinity for the
progesterone receptor , only about 12.5% of that of
progesterone and about 2.5% of that of
19-norprogesterone in one
assay .
[4] On the other hand, gestronol had far higher affinity than
17α-hydroxyprogesterone , which showed less than 0.1% of the affinity of progesterone for the progesterone receptor.
[4]
